<title>MIPS: Disable Loongson MMI instructions for kernel build</title>
<updated>2019-10-17T20:42:45+00:00</updated>
<author>
<name>Paul Burton</name>
<email>paul.burton@mips.com</email>
</author>
<published>2019-10-10T18:54:03+00:00</published>
<link rel='alternate' type='text/html' href='https://git.exis.tech/linux.git/commit/?id=83c3684d71eba85d8020e345e08d9b1ba2d3a922'/>
<id>83c3684d71eba85d8020e345e08d9b1ba2d3a922</id>
<content type='text'>
commit 2f2b4fd674cadd8c6b40eb629e140a14db4068fd upstream.

GCC 9.x automatically enables support for Loongson MMI instructions when
using some -march= flags, and then errors out when -msoft-float is
specified with:

  cc1: error: ‘-mloongson-mmi’ must be used with ‘-mhard-float’

The kernel shouldn't be using these MMI instructions anyway, just as it
doesn't use floating point instructions. Explicitly disable them in
order to fix the build with GCC 9.x.

<title>MIPS: VDSO: Use same -m%-float cflag as the kernel proper</title>
<updated>2019-09-21T05:14:05+00:00</updated>
<author>
<name>Paul Burton</name>
<email>paul.burton@mips.com</email>
</author>
<published>2019-01-28T22:21:17+00:00</published>
<link rel='alternate' type='text/html' href='https://git.exis.tech/linux.git/commit/?id=0bb1b6495f2a77c5fe0568779022a8cfaa0c6966'/>
<id>0bb1b6495f2a77c5fe0568779022a8cfaa0c6966</id>
<content type='text'>
commit 0648e50e548d881d025b9419a1a168753c8e2bf7 upstream.

The MIPS VDSO build currently doesn't provide the -msoft-float flag to
the compiler as the kernel proper does. This results in an attempt to
use the compiler's default floating point configuration, which can be
problematic in cases where this is incompatible with the target CPU's
-march= flag. For example decstation_defconfig fails to build using
toolchains in which gcc was configured --with-fp-32=xx with the
following error:

    LDS     arch/mips/vdso/vdso.lds
  cc1: error: '-march=r3000' requires '-mfp32'
  make[2]: *** [scripts/Makefile.build:379: arch/mips/vdso/vdso.lds] Error 1

The kernel proper avoids this error because we build with the
-msoft-float compiler flag, rather than using the compiler's default.
Pass this flag through to the VDSO build so that it too becomes agnostic
to the toolchain's floating point configuration.

Note that this is filtered out from KBUILD_CFLAGS rather than simply
always using -msoft-float such that if we switch the kernel to use
-mno-float in the future the VDSO will automatically inherit the change.

The VDSO doesn't actually include any floating point code, and its
.MIPS.abiflags section is already manually generated to specify that
it's compatible with any floating point ABI. As such this change should
have no effect on the resulting VDSO, apart from fixing the build
failure for affected toolchains.

<title>MIPS: VDSO: Include $(ccflags-vdso) in o32,n32 .lds builds</title>
<updated>2019-02-15T07:07:38+00:00</updated>
<author>
<name>Paul Burton</name>
<email>paul.burton@mips.com</email>
</author>
<published>2019-01-28T23:16:22+00:00</published>
<link rel='alternate' type='text/html' href='https://git.exis.tech/linux.git/commit/?id=f16d21d81263facf926eafb0e536209fca4a2907'/>
<id>f16d21d81263facf926eafb0e536209fca4a2907</id>
<content type='text'>
commit 67fc5dc8a541e8f458d7f08bf88ff55933bf9f9d upstream.

When generating vdso-o32.lds &amp; vdso-n32.lds for use with programs
running as compat ABIs under 64b kernels, we previously haven't included
the compiler flags that are supposedly common to all ABIs - ie. those in
the ccflags-vdso variable.

This is problematic in cases where we need to provide the -m%-float flag
in order to ensure that we don't attempt to use a floating point ABI
that's incompatible with the target CPU &amp; ABI. For example a toolchain
using current gcc trunk configured --with-fp-32=xx fails to build a
64r6el_defconfig kernel with the following error:

  cc1: error: '-march=mips1' requires '-mfp32'
  make[2]: *** [arch/mips/vdso/Makefile:135: arch/mips/vdso/vdso-o32.lds] Error 1

Include $(ccflags-vdso) for the compat VDSO .lds builds, just as it is
included for the native VDSO .lds &amp; when compiling objects for the
compat VDSOs. This ensures we consistently provide the -msoft-float flag
amongst others, avoiding the problem by ensuring we're agnostic to the
toolchain defaults.

<title>MIPS: Fix -mabi=64 build of vdso.lds</title>
<updated>2016-10-11T13:03:47+00:00</updated>
<author>
<name>James Hogan</name>
<email>james.hogan@imgtec.com</email>
</author>
<published>2016-10-06T22:10:41+00:00</published>
<link rel='alternate' type='text/html' href='https://git.exis.tech/linux.git/commit/?id=034827c727f7f3946a18355b63995b402c226c82'/>
<id>034827c727f7f3946a18355b63995b402c226c82</id>
<content type='text'>
The native ABI vDSO linker script vdso.lds is built by preprocessing
vdso.lds.S, with the native -mabi flag passed in to get the correct ABI
definitions. Unfortunately however certain toolchains choke on -mabi=64
without a corresponding compatible -march flag, for example:

cc1: error: ‘-march=mips32r2’ is not compatible with the selected ABI
scripts/Makefile.build:338: recipe for target 'arch/mips/vdso/vdso.lds' failed

Fix this by including ccflags-vdso in the KBUILD_CPPFLAGS for vdso.lds,
which includes the appropriate -march flag.

<title>MIPS: Fix genvdso error on rebuild</title>
<updated>2016-05-13T20:47:39+00:00</updated>
<author>
<name>James Hogan</name>
<email>james.hogan@imgtec.com</email>
</author>
<published>2016-05-13T18:41:06+00:00</published>
<link rel='alternate' type='text/html' href='https://git.exis.tech/linux.git/commit/?id=2afb97454347f641dd2435a3956ba12f816fb1df'/>
<id>2afb97454347f641dd2435a3956ba12f816fb1df</id>
<content type='text'>
The genvdso program modifies the debug and stripped versions of the
VDSOs in place, and errors if the modification has already taken place.
Unfortunately this means that a rebuild which tries to rerun genvdso to
generate vdso*-image.c without also rebuilding vdso.so.dbg (for example
if genvdso.c is modified) hits a build error like this:

arch/mips/vdso/genvdso 'arch/mips/vdso/vdso.so.dbg' already contains a '.MIPS.abiflags' section

This is fixed by reorganising the rules such that unmodified .so files
have a .raw suffix, and these are copied in the same rule that runs
genvdso on the copies.

I.e. previously we had:

 cmd_vdsold:
  link objects -&gt; vdso.so.dbg

 cmd_genvdso:
  strip vdso.so.dbg -&gt; vdso.so
  run genvdso -&gt; vdso-image.c
   and modify vdso.so.dbg and vdso.so in place

Now we have:

 cmd_vdsold:
  link objects -&gt; vdso.so.dbg.raw

 a new cmd_objcopy based strip rule (inspired by ARM):
  strip vdso.so.dbg.raw -&gt; vdso.so.raw

 cmd_genvdso:
  copy vdso.so.dbg.raw -&gt; vdso.so.dbg
  copy vdso.so.raw -&gt; vdso.so
  run genvdso -&gt; vdso-image.c
   and modify vdso.so.dbg and vdso.so in place

<title>Fix ld-version.sh to handle large 3rd version part</title>
<updated>2016-01-04T09:22:52+00:00</updated>
<author>
<name>James Hogan</name>
<email>james.hogan@imgtec.com</email>
</author>
<published>2015-12-26T22:47:52+00:00</published>
<link rel='alternate' type='text/html' href='https://git.exis.tech/linux.git/commit/?id=d5ece1cb074b2c7082c9a2948ac598dd0ad40657'/>
<id>d5ece1cb074b2c7082c9a2948ac598dd0ad40657</id>
<content type='text'>
The ld-version.sh script doesn't handle versions with large (&gt;= 10) 3rd
version components, because the 2nd component is only multiplied by 10
times that of the 3rd component.

For example the following version string:
GNU ld (Codescape GNU Tools 2015.06-05 for MIPS MTI Linux) 2.24.90

gives a bogus version number:
 20000000
+ 2400000
+  900000 = 23300000

Breakage, confusion and mole-whacking ensues.

Increase the multipliers of the first two version components by a factor
of 10 to give space for a 3rd components of up to 99, and update the
sole user of ld-ifversion (MIPS VDSO) accordingly.
